2016-06-09 102 views
0

我念叨之间通知类型和数据类型的差异GCM文件,当你想将消息发送到移动设备。谷歌云消息通知VS数据

他们说,通知类型总是崩溃,但对我来说它不清楚它意味着什么?

这是否意味着如果我发送两个或更多的通知(在用户能够打开前一个通知之前),只有最后一个可见?

回答

2

可折叠或不可收缩

的推送消息可以是可折叠的或不可折叠的。 “可折叠”意味着最近的消息覆盖排队发送的任何先前消息。可折叠消息的典型示例是实时游戏分数。如果以前的分数更新还没有到达目的地,那么Android客户端只会获得最新的分数。然而,这是以尽力而为的方式发生的:消息在GCM中发送的顺序无法保证,因此在某些情况下,“最新”消息实际上可能不是最新消息。

通知:设置通知负载。可能有可选数据有效载荷。始终可折叠。

数据:仅设置数据有效载荷。可以是可折叠的也可以是不可折叠的。